How much do wags j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for wags in the United States is $13.26,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.26 and $14.18 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Wags, and what do they do?

Wags is a pet care service company that primarily offers dog walking, pet sitting, and related pet care services. Their professionals, often referred to as 'Wag! Walkers,' provide on-demand or scheduled dog walks, pet sitting, boarding, and drop-in visits. The company connects pet owners with vetted caregivers through a mobile app, ensuring pets receive exercise, care, and attention when their owners are away or busy. Wags also offers features like real-time GPS tracking, photo updates, and personalized care instructions to give pet owners peace of mind. Their services are available in many cities across the United States.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Dog Walker (Wags) and why are they important?

To thrive as a Dog Walker, you need a genuine love for animals, physical stamina, and a basic understanding of pet care, often supported by prior experience with dogs. Familiarity with GPS tracking apps, scheduling systems, and pet first aid certification is typically beneficial. Excellent communication, reliability, and patience help foster positive relationships with both clients and their pets. These skills ensure the safety, well-being, and satisfaction of the dogs and their owners, which is crucial for building trust and repeat business.

What are some common challenges faced by dog walkers working with Wags, and how can they be managed?

Dog walkers working with Wags often encounter challenges such as managing unpredictable pet behavior, navigating varied weather conditions, and coordinating schedules with pet owners. Building strong communication with clients and understanding each dog's needs can help prevent issues during walks. Additionally, staying organized and using Wags' app features can streamline scheduling and ensure all client instructions are followed, leading to a smoother experience both for the walker and the pets.
